Compartilhar via


SqlMISink interface

Um coletor da Instância Gerenciada de SQL do Azure da atividade de cópia.

Extends

Propriedades

preCopyScript

Script de pré-cópia do SQL. Tipo: cadeia de caracteres (ou Expressão com cadeia de caracteres resultType).

sqlWriterStoredProcedureName

Nome do procedimento armazenado do gravador SQL. Tipo: cadeia de caracteres (ou Expressão com cadeia de caracteres resultType).

sqlWriterTableType

Tipo de tabela de gravador SQL. Tipo: cadeia de caracteres (ou Expressão com cadeia de caracteres resultType).

sqlWriterUseTableLock

Se deve usar o bloqueio de tabela durante a cópia em massa. Tipo: booliano (ou Expressão com resultType booleano).

storedProcedureParameters

Parâmetros de procedimento armazenado do SQL.

storedProcedureTableTypeParameterName

O nome do parâmetro de procedimento armazenado do tipo de tabela. Tipo: cadeia de caracteres (ou Expressão com cadeia de caracteres resultType).

tableOption

A opção para manipular a tabela do coletor, como o autoCreate. Por enquanto, há suporte apenas para o valor 'autoCreate'. Tipo: cadeia de caracteres (ou Expressão com cadeia de caracteres resultType).

type

Discriminatório polimórfico, que especifica os diferentes tipos que esse objeto pode ser

upsertSettings

Configurações de upsert do SQL.

writeBehavior

Comportamento em branco ao copiar dados para a MI do SQL do Azure. Tipo: cadeia de caracteres (ou Expressão com cadeia de caracteres resultType)

Propriedades herdadas

disableMetricsCollection

Se for true, desabilite a coleta de métricas do armazenamento de dados. O padrão é false. Tipo: booliano (ou Expressão com resultType booleano).

maxConcurrentConnections

A contagem máxima de conexões simultâneas para o armazenamento de dados do coletor. Tipo: inteiro (ou Expressão com inteiro resultType).

sinkRetryCount

Contagem de repetições do coletor. Tipo: inteiro (ou Expressão com inteiro resultType).

sinkRetryWait

Espera de repetição do coletor. Tipo: cadeia de caracteres (ou Expressão com cadeia de caracteres resultType), padrão: ((\d+).)? (\d\d):(60|( [0-5][0-9])):(60|( [0-5][0-9])).

writeBatchSize

Gravar tamanho do lote. Tipo: inteiro (ou Expressão com número inteiro resultType), mínimo: 0.

writeBatchTimeout

Tempo limite de gravação em lote. Tipo: cadeia de caracteres (ou Expressão com cadeia de caracteres resultType), padrão: ((\d+).)? (\d\d):(60|( [0-5][0-9])):(60|( [0-5][0-9])).

Detalhes da propriedade

preCopyScript

Script de pré-cópia do SQL. Tipo: cadeia de caracteres (ou Expressão com cadeia de caracteres resultType).

preCopyScript?: any

Valor da propriedade

any

sqlWriterStoredProcedureName

Nome do procedimento armazenado do gravador SQL. Tipo: cadeia de caracteres (ou Expressão com cadeia de caracteres resultType).

sqlWriterStoredProcedureName?: any

Valor da propriedade

any

sqlWriterTableType

Tipo de tabela de gravador SQL. Tipo: cadeia de caracteres (ou Expressão com cadeia de caracteres resultType).

sqlWriterTableType?: any

Valor da propriedade

any

sqlWriterUseTableLock

Se deve usar o bloqueio de tabela durante a cópia em massa. Tipo: booliano (ou Expressão com resultType booleano).

sqlWriterUseTableLock?: any

Valor da propriedade

any

storedProcedureParameters

Parâmetros de procedimento armazenado do SQL.

storedProcedureParameters?: any

Valor da propriedade

any

storedProcedureTableTypeParameterName

O nome do parâmetro de procedimento armazenado do tipo de tabela. Tipo: cadeia de caracteres (ou Expressão com cadeia de caracteres resultType).

storedProcedureTableTypeParameterName?: any

Valor da propriedade

any

tableOption

A opção para manipular a tabela do coletor, como o autoCreate. Por enquanto, há suporte apenas para o valor 'autoCreate'. Tipo: cadeia de caracteres (ou Expressão com cadeia de caracteres resultType).

tableOption?: any

Valor da propriedade

any

type

Discriminatório polimórfico, que especifica os diferentes tipos que esse objeto pode ser

type: "SqlMISink"

Valor da propriedade

"SqlMISink"

upsertSettings

Configurações de upsert do SQL.

upsertSettings?: SqlUpsertSettings

Valor da propriedade

writeBehavior

Comportamento em branco ao copiar dados para a MI do SQL do Azure. Tipo: cadeia de caracteres (ou Expressão com cadeia de caracteres resultType)

writeBehavior?: any

Valor da propriedade

any

Detalhes das propriedades herdadas

disableMetricsCollection

Se for true, desabilite a coleta de métricas do armazenamento de dados. O padrão é false. Tipo: booliano (ou Expressão com resultType booleano).

disableMetricsCollection?: any

Valor da propriedade

any

Herdado deCopySink.disableMetricsCollection

maxConcurrentConnections

A contagem máxima de conexões simultâneas para o armazenamento de dados do coletor. Tipo: inteiro (ou Expressão com inteiro resultType).

maxConcurrentConnections?: any

Valor da propriedade

any

Herdado deCopySink.maxConcurrentConnections

sinkRetryCount

Contagem de repetições do coletor. Tipo: inteiro (ou Expressão com inteiro resultType).

sinkRetryCount?: any

Valor da propriedade

any

Herdado deCopySink.sinkRetryCount

sinkRetryWait

Espera de repetição do coletor. Tipo: cadeia de caracteres (ou Expressão com cadeia de caracteres resultType), padrão: ((\d+).)? (\d\d):(60|( [0-5][0-9])):(60|( [0-5][0-9])).

sinkRetryWait?: any

Valor da propriedade

any

herdado de CopySink.sinkRetryWait

writeBatchSize

Gravar tamanho do lote. Tipo: inteiro (ou Expressão com número inteiro resultType), mínimo: 0.

writeBatchSize?: any

Valor da propriedade

any

Herdado deCopySink.writeBatchSize

writeBatchTimeout

Tempo limite de gravação em lote. Tipo: cadeia de caracteres (ou Expressão com cadeia de caracteres resultType), padrão: ((\d+).)? (\d\d):(60|( [0-5][0-9])):(60|( [0-5][0-9])).

writeBatchTimeout?: any

Valor da propriedade

any

Herdado deCopySink.writeBatchTimeout